  10. G1111

    G1111 Registered Member

    Alll are used in real time except the on demand scanners. MBAM Pro uses quite a bit RAM, but does not slow down my system. EMET & SpywareBlaster do not use any resources. I use the ClearCloud utility rather then type in the servers. This would save a few MBs by just manually typing the two entries. The current setup does not seem to slow my system which is always a concern and the programs work together with no conflict. I used Kaspersky AV up until the 2011 version which did not work well on my system. I had a free one year Emsisoft Anti-Malware license so I switched over to that and am extremely satisfied. When the license came up for renewal I purchased through SurfRight. I saved a few dollars and got a year's license for Hitman Pro for free.
